mandible
noun man·di·ble \ˈman-də-bəl\
Medical Definition of MANDIBLE
2
: any of various invertebrate mouthparts serving to hold or bite food materials; especially : either member of the anterior pair of mouth appendages of an arthropod often forming strong biting jaws
